Roman Republican Coinage, L. Livineius Regulus, Denarii (2), 42, bare head of the praetor L. Livineius Regulus right, l regvlvs p r around, rev. curule chair between two fasces, regvlvs above, praef v [r] in exergue, 3.71g; similar to last but without legend, rev. combat with wild beasts, l regvl[vs] in exergue, 3.64g (Craw. 494/31, 494/30; RSC Livineia 8, 12) [2]. About fine, second off-centre on reverse £80-£100
